通八洲科技

Linux中Compton的配置文件解析

日期:2025-04-01 00:00 / 作者:月夜之吻

Compton是一款强大的Linux窗口管理器,用于在Wayland和X11环境下实现窗口透明效果,提升桌面美观度和易用性。其配置文件通常位于~/.config/compton.conf,也可通过命令行参数配置。本文将详细解析Compton配置文件的关键选项。

核心配置参数:

窗口管理器集成:

透明度控制:

其他高级选项:

配置文件示例:

以下是一个示例配置文件,展示了如何设置不同的透明度规则:

backend = "x11";
glx-version = "3.3";
shader = "/usr/share/compton/shader.frag";
alpha-threshold = 0.5;

wm = "i3";
workspace = 4;
focus = "click";

opacity-rule = [
    "CLASS = 'Firefox', opacity = 0.9;",  // Firefox浏览器透明度为90%
    "CLASS = 'GIMP', opacity = 0.8;"     // GIMP图像编辑器透明度为80%
];

fade = true;
fade-delta = 0.05;

log-level = "info";
pid-file = "/tmp/compton.pid";
disable-xinerama = false;
disable-gpu-compositing = false;

修改配置文件后,请重启Compton使设置生效。 记住根据您的实际需求调整参数,并仔细阅读Compton的官方文档以获取更详细的信息。